mobile menu
mobile menu
About
FAQ
Home
Specialties
Oklahoma City, OK, 73139
Lauren Cochell
Lauren Cochell
24 Sw 89th St
Oklahoma City, OK, 73139
(405) 838-1038
Physician
Profile
Lauren Cochell, graduated from in . Her primary practice is as .